    Citizen participation in news

    No full text
    The process of producing news has changed significantly due to the advent of the Web, which has enabled the increasing involvement of citizens in news production. This trend has been given many names, including participatory journalism, produsage, and crowd-sourced journalism, but these terms are ambiguous and have been applied inconsistently, making comparison of news systems difficult. In particular, it is problematic to distinguish the levels of citizen involvement, and therefore the extent to which news production has genuinely been opened up. In this paper we perform an analysis of 32 online news systems, comparing them in terms of how much power they give to citizens at each stage of the news production process. Our analysis reveals a diverse landscape of news systems and shows that they defy simplistic categorisation, but it also provides the means to compare different approaches in a systematic and meaningful way. We combine this with four case studies of individual stories to explore the ways that news stories can move and evolve across this landscape. Our conclusions are that online news systems are complex and interdependent, and that most do not involve citizens to the extent that the terms used to describe them imply

    ‘Decolonisation’ in China, 1949-1959

    No full text
    In this chapter Jonathan Howlett adopts perspectives and models from wider literatures on decolonisation to explore the Chinese Communist Party’s elimination of the British semi-colonial presence from China after the revolution of 1949 and to place it within its global context. He focuses in particular on the CCP’s attempts to address the economic, cultural and human legacies of semi-colonialism within a comparative context. In so doing, the author seeks to complicate our understanding of the Sino-British relationship by exploring one of its most dramatic phases and to further illuminate this neglected period in Chinese history

    Jonathan Swift in Context

    No full text
    Jonathan Swift remains the most important and influential satirist in the English language. The author of Gulliver\u27s Travels, A Modest Proposal, and A Tale of a Tub, in addition to vast numbers of political pamphlets, satirical verses, sermons, and other kinds of text, Swift is one of the most versatile writers in the literary canon. His writings were always closely intertwined with the English and Irish worlds in which he lived. The forty-four essays collected in Jonathan Swift in Context advance the latest research on Swift in a way that will engage undergraduate students while also remaining useful for scholars. Reflecting the best of current and ongoing scholarship, the contextual approach advanced by this volume will help to make Swift\u27s works even more powerful and resonant to modern audiences

    Determination of critical cooling rates in metallic glass forming alloy libraries through laser spike annealing

    No full text
    The glass forming ability (GFA) of metallic glasses (MGs) is quantified by the critical cooling rate (RC). Despite its key role in MG research, experimental challenges have limited measured RC to a minute fraction of known glass formers. We present a combinatorial approach to directly measure RC for large compositional ranges. This is realized through the use of compositionally-graded alloy libraries, which were photo-thermally heated by scanning laser spike annealing of an absorbing layer, then melted and cooled at various rates. Coupled with X-ray diffraction mapping, GFA is determined from direct RC measurements. We exemplify this technique for the Au-Cu-Si system, where we identify Au56Cu27Si17 as the alloy with the highest GFA. In general, this method enables measurements of RC over large compositional areas, which is powerful for materials discovery and, when correlating with chemistry and other properties, for a deeper understanding of MG formation.Peer reviewe
